Most 50 cc ATVs reach roughly 20–35 mph (32–56 km/h), depending on the specific model, rider weight, and terrain. Beginner or youth-focused models are often speed-limited to about 10–20 mph for safety.

Factors that influence top speed
Several design and operating factors shape how fast a 50 cc ATV can go. The following list highlights the most impactful ones.
- Engine design and displacement within the 50 cc class; two-stroke engines often produce different power curves than four-strokes.
- Power delivery and gearing (CVT or torque-converter, final drive ratio, and any built-in speed limiter).
- Rider weight and ballast, which affect acceleration and attainable top speed.
- Tire size and traction; larger or more aggressive tires can alter gearing and rolling resistance, impacting top speed.
- Altitude and temperature; lower air density at altitude and heat can reduce engine output slightly.
- Maintenance and fuel quality; dirty air filters or poor fuel can sap performance.
- Terrain and surface type (pavement, trails, sand, mud) which affect rolling resistance and acceleration.
In short, top speed is the result of power, gearing, weight, and conditions. Even small changes in these factors can shift top speed by several mph.
Typical speed ranges by use case
To give a practical sense of what you can expect, here are common speed ranges by intended use and model category for 50 cc ATVs.
- Beginner/kid-focused models: roughly 10–20 mph (16–32 km/h), often with adjustable or factory-set limits for safety.
- Standard youth/entry-level models: about 20–30 mph (32–48 km/h), suitable for learning and casual trail riding.
- Sport-oriented or higher-performance 50 cc models: around 30–40 mph (48–64 km/h), though some fast-trimmed variants may push toward the upper end on smooth surfaces.
- Rare high-performance or tuned setups: occasional cases above 40 mph, but these are unusual and often not road-legal or recommended for beginners.
These ranges are approximate and can vary by manufacturer, region, and rider. Always check the manufacturer’s specifications and ensure the model is appropriate for the rider’s age and experience.

What to check before buying
Before purchasing a 50 cc ATV, verify gear ratio options, whether the model has an adjustable or removable speed limiter, weight rating, and overall build quality. Look for a durable frame, reliable CVT, straightforward maintenance, and strong dealer support. Consider the rider’s age, experience, and typical riding environment to pick a speed range that suits them.
